billc wrote: > >Yes, apache2 with Postfix. > >Ok, that makes sense now. Apache and Postfix have been restarted, >but unfortunately I'm not connecting. > >Mailman list has been created. >Testlist and testlist2 have been created. >All three are in archives/private/ >The "Your new mailing list: testlist2" email was sent and received. > >I'm getting /mailman/admin/testlist2 was not found on this server, >and similar for all other URLs I've attempted. > >I'm running virtual domains, in case that makes a difference.
Do you have the proper ScriptAlias /mailman/ /correct/path/ in your httpd.conf where it will apply to this host? And what's in your Apache error_log?
